static const char app[] = "ChanIsAvail";
/*** DOCUMENTATION
<application name="ChanIsAvail" language="en_US">
<synopsis>
Check channel availability
</synopsis>
<syntax>
<parameter name="Technology/Resource" required="false" argsep="&amp;">
<argument name="Technology/Resource" required="true">
<para>Specification of the device(s) to check. These must be in the format of
<literal>Technology/Resource</literal>, where <replaceable>Technology</replaceable>
represents a particular channel driver, and <replaceable>Resource</replaceable>
represents a resource available to that particular channel driver.</para>
</argument>
<argument name="Technology2/Resource2" multiple="true">
<para>Optional extra devices to check</para>
<para>If you need more than one enter them as
Technology2/Resource2&amp;Technology3/Resource3&amp;.....</para>
</argument>
</parameter>
<parameter name="options" required="false">
<optionlist>
<option name="a">
<para>Check for all available channels, not only the first one</para>
</option>
<option name="s">
<para>Consider the channel unavailable if the channel is in use at all</para>
</option>
<option name="t" implies="s">
<para>Simply checks if specified channels exist in the channel list</para>
</option>
</optionlist>
</parameter>
</syntax>
<description>
<para>This application will check to see if any of the specified channels are available.</para>
<para>This application sets the following channel variables:</para>
<variablelist>
<variable name="AVAILCHAN">
<para>The name of the available channel, if one exists</para>
</variable>
<variable name="AVAILORIGCHAN">
<para>The canonical channel name that was used to create the channel</para>
</variable>
<variable name="AVAILSTATUS">
<para>The device state for the device</para>
</variable>
<variable name="AVAILCAUSECODE">
<para>The cause code returned when requesting the channel</para>
</variable>
</variablelist>
</description>
</application>
***/
static int chanavail_exec(struct ast_channel *chan, const char *data)
{
int inuse = -1;
int option_state = 0;
int string_compare = 0;
int option_all_avail = 0;
int status;
char *info;
char trychan[512];
char *rest;
char *tech;
char *number;
struct ast_str *tmp_availchan = ast_str_alloca(2048);
struct ast_str *tmp_availorig = ast_str_alloca(2048);
struct ast_str *tmp_availstat = ast_str_alloca(2048);
struct ast_str *tmp_availcause = ast_str_alloca(2048);
struct ast_channel *tempchan;
struct ast_custom_function *cdr_prop_func = ast_custom_function_find("CDR_PROP");
struct ast_format_cap *caps = NULL;
AST_DECLARE_APP_ARGS(args,
AST_APP_ARG(reqchans);
AST_APP_ARG(options);
);
info = ast_strdupa(data ?: "");
AST_STANDARD_APP_ARGS(args, info);
ao2_lock(chan);
caps = ao2_bump(ast_channel_nativeformats(chan));
ao2_unlock(chan);
if (args.options) {
if (strchr(args.options, 'a')) {
option_all_avail = 1;
}
if (strchr(args.options, 's')) {
option_state = 1;
}
if (strchr(args.options, 't')) {
string_compare = 1;
}
}
rest = args.reqchans;
if (!rest) {
rest = "";
}
while ((tech = strsep(&rest, "&"))) {
tech = ast_strip(tech);
number = strchr(tech, '/');
if (!number) {
if (!ast_strlen_zero(tech)) {
ast_log(LOG_WARNING, "Invalid ChanIsAvail technology/resource argument: '%s'\n",
tech);
}
ast_str_append(&tmp_availstat, 0, "%s%d",
ast_str_strlen(tmp_availstat) ? "&" : "", AST_DEVICE_INVALID);
continue;
}
*number++ = '\0';
status = AST_DEVICE_UNKNOWN;
if (string_compare) {
/* ast_parse_device_state checks for "SIP/1234" as a channel name.
ast_device_state will ask the SIP driver for the channel state. */
snprintf(trychan, sizeof(trychan), "%s/%s", tech, number);
status = inuse = ast_parse_device_state(trychan);
} else if (option_state) {
/* If the pbx says in use then don't bother trying further.
This is to permit testing if someone's on a call, even if the
channel can permit more calls (ie callwaiting, sip calls, etc). */
snprintf(trychan, sizeof(trychan), "%s/%s", tech, number);
status = inuse = ast_device_state(trychan);
}
ast_str_append(&tmp_availstat, 0, "%s%d", ast_str_strlen(tmp_availstat) ? "&" : "", status);
if ((inuse <= (int) AST_DEVICE_NOT_INUSE)
&& (tempchan = ast_request(tech, caps, NULL, chan, number, &status))) {
ast_str_append(&tmp_availchan, 0, "%s%s",
ast_str_strlen(tmp_availchan) ? "&" : "", ast_channel_name(tempchan));
ast_str_append(&tmp_availorig, 0, "%s%s/%s",
ast_str_strlen(tmp_availorig) ? "&" : "", tech, number);
ast_str_append(&tmp_availcause, 0, "%s%d",
ast_str_strlen(tmp_availcause) ? "&" : "", status);
/* Disable CDR for this temporary channel. */
if (cdr_prop_func) {
ast_func_write(tempchan, "CDR_PROP(disable)", "1");
}
ast_hangup(tempchan);
tempchan = NULL;
if (!option_all_avail) {
break;
}
}
}
ao2_cleanup(caps);
pbx_builtin_setvar_helper(chan, "AVAILCHAN", ast_str_buffer(tmp_availchan));
/* Store the originally used channel too */
pbx_builtin_setvar_helper(chan, "AVAILORIGCHAN", ast_str_buffer(tmp_availorig));
pbx_builtin_setvar_helper(chan, "AVAILSTATUS", ast_str_buffer(tmp_availstat));
pbx_builtin_setvar_helper(chan, "AVAILCAUSECODE", ast_str_buffer(tmp_availcause));
return 0;
}
